Output 43cda5b75240a75cfbbaf8c6d7b8b71c764307079d0fcf5c0cd5f3af340a3e75:0

value
670500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c3f923e49f41bfd5c29b0b0c5f40209d6dfaa4e OP_EQUALVERIFY OP_CHECKSIG
address
17xAWb6gobgCjhGKqy1HReCouLXMJASQe6
transaction
43cda5b75240a75cfbbaf8c6d7b8b71c764307079d0fcf5c0cd5f3af340a3e75
spent
true